Ham & Broccoli Crock Pot Casserole

ingredients

  • 453.59 g package frozen broccoli florets, thawed and drained
  • 709.77 ml cooked ham, cubed
  • 297.66 g can cream of chicken soup
  • 226.79 g jar processed cheese (Ragu, Cheese Whiz, etc...)
  • 236.59 ml milk
  • 236.59 ml instant rice, uncooked
  • 1 stalk celery, diced
  • 1 small onion, diced

directions

  • Combine broccoli and ham in crock pot.
  • Combine soup, cheese sauce, milk, rice, celery and onion.
  • Stir into soup mixture into ham mixture.
  • Cook on low 4-5 hours- make sure rice is tender.
